178,859,106,860 is an even composite number composed of six pr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 178859106860 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 6 prime factors (large circles) and 96 divisors.

178859106860 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of ninety-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 178859106860:

22 × 5 × 7 × 157 × 523 × 15559

(2 × 2 × 5 × 7 × 157 × 523 × 15559)
